Commercial masonry repair services involve the restoration and maintenance of existing masonry structures to ensure their stability, appearance, and longevity. These services typically address issues such as cracked or crumbling brickwork, damaged mortar joints, spalling concrete, and other forms of deterioration that can compromise the integrity of a building’s masonry components. Skilled professionals assess the extent of damage and employ techniques like repointing, patching, sealing, and replacement of damaged materials to restore the structure’s original strength and aesthetic appeal. Proper repair work not only enhances the visual appeal of a property but also helps prevent further deterioration that could lead to costly repairs down the line.
These services are essential for solving common masonry problems that arise over time due to exposure to weather, ground movement, or structural shifts. Cracks and mortar deterioration can allow water infiltration, which may cause internal damage or mold growth. Spalling concrete and loose bricks can pose safety hazards and reduce the overall stability of a structure. Commercial properties often face these issues in high-traffic areas or structures subjected to frequent use, making timely repairs vital for maintaining safety and appearance. Professional masonry repair helps property owners address these problems efficiently, extending the lifespan of the building’s masonry elements.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sewickley,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ost for materials in commercial masonry repair typically ranges from $10 to $25 per square foot, depending on the type of stone or brick involved. For example, repairing a 200-square-foot wall may cost between $2,000 and $5,000 in mater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for masonry repair services generally fall between $40 and $80 per hour. A standard repair project might take 8 to 16 hours, resulting in total labor charges of $320 to $1,280.
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more complex repairs can significantly increase costs, with projects over 1,000 square feet potentially costing $15,000 or more. Smaller, straightforward repairs typically range from $1,000 to $5,000.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include scaffolding, cleanup, or special sealants,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all project cost. These factors vary based on the specific requirements of the repair site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ial masonry repair services are available? Local contractors typically offer services such as brick and block repair, mortar joint restoration, crack filling, and structural stabilization for commercial properties.
How can I tell if my commercial masonry need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ose or bulging bricks, deteriorated mortar, or water infiltration around masonry walls.
What are common causes of masonry damage in commercial buildings? Damage often results from weather exposure, ground movement, improper installation, or aging materials.
